BIDDING NOTES: If you bid on an EMPTY LOT, it is EMPTY, you get nothing. If you bid and it does not turn blue, you are not winning. It will be very clear you are winning. It will be blue and say “Winning”. You will not WIN the item until it changes to WON at the end of the auction after the final timer expires. You may enter a max bid so the computer can bid for you until you win or run out of money. You can bid again or edit the max bid. A tie bid happens when you match a prior max bid, but the first bidder with money in the system will be winning. Example: Current bid and your bid are $50, but it’s black and red. Another bidder beat you with a max bid. Not blue, not winning. You need to be $51 to make it turn blue and show “winning”. Check your spam folder for emails. We send them, always. Refresh your browser often if you don't have the app. Best experience: Download, install and log into our FREE APP - Midwest Auctions - on your phone from any app store for outbid alerts and updates. Never assume you won it. Keep checking, even after it hits "0". A last second bid could restart the timer before your computer refreshes. You will only have WON if it changes to WON from WINNING at the end. Clear your computer browser history and cookies often. If you don't have the app, keep your email window open so you can check your outbid notices there. BID ENTRY ERRORS: The system does not take pennies. Please don’t add them. $10.00 = a $1000 bid.
